  • Hi Friends,

    Basically I need to create an environment where I can get alert whenever any new login or user would be created.

    The following below information should store to monitortable which will available in database.

    - Login Name / User Name which created

    - Name of the Which user created

    - Creation Date

    - Login Type

    Please feel free to ask if any doubt regarding my query.

  • The easy way is to check on Syslogins, from there you can see the createdate, updatedate and accessdate of all logins for the server. you can play around with this 🙂

  • In SQL 2005 I would go with Event Notifications for CREATE\ALTER\DROP Login. You could also use DDL triggers, but Event Notifications is more suited if you want to send a meesage to an operator or another server.

    For SQL 2000 you're only option is to monitor the syslogins table like Crazyman said.
